Prior to J.J. Abrams’ 2007 TED talk The Mystery Box, mainstream screenwriting scholarship split mystery craft and long-form serial structure into isolated siloed fields. Classic Hitchcockian MacGuffin theory centered standalone feature film objects with definitive third-act resolutions, while television writing manuals prioritized linear character arcs and episodic closure. Early two-thousands broadcast drama relied on self-contained weekly plots that resolved every core question to satisfy casual viewers, with minimal academic analysis of sustained multi-season unresolved intrigue. As digital fan forums and online theorizing expanded audience participation, there emerged an unmet need for a unified storytelling framework that leverages curiosity as a core narrative engine. Abrams’ Mystery Box theory fills this gap by building a cross-medium system rooted in his childhood unopened magic box anecdote, redefining mystery not as a temporary plot twist, but as an ongoing structural narrative force usable across film, serialized TV, and transmedia storytelling. For contemporary media creators navigating streaming’s binge-view landscape, this framework resolves the critical tension between audience short-term satisfaction and long-term sustained engagement.

Alfred Hitchcock’s MacGuffin theory dominated suspense narrative analysis from the nineteen-fifties onward, built entirely around self-contained theatrical films with complete third-act payoffs. Serial television scholarship of the nineteen-nineties and early two-thousands focused on episodic closure, as broadcast networks demanded each episode wrap core conflicts. Abrams’ personal creative practice refined the Mystery logic through Alias and early Lost development, before he formalized the metaphor via his childhood magic box story for the March 2007 TED stage. Post-TED, media studies scholars began publishing comparative analyses between MacGuffin and Mystery Box structures, while streaming showrunners adopted the framework to design long-burn bingeable IP. Critical debate emerged around Lost’s divisive finale, highlighting the theory’s implementation risks when layered questions lack cohesive thematic payoff.
Two competing suspense narrative frameworks dominate screenwriting education before Abrams’ synthesis. The closed MacGuffin model argues all central mysteries require full, satisfying resolution within a single narrative unit. Abrams’ open Mystery Box model holds that sustained, partial revelation of nested questions creates superior long-term audience investment, even if some minor enigmas remain unresolved. Traditional feature film screenwriting training adheres to the closed MacGuffin standard, while modern streaming serial development teams prioritize the Mystery Box layered curiosity structure.
Major implementation gaps exist between the TED framework and on-set series writing rooms; many creators adopt surface-level endless questions without layered hierarchical design, resulting in incoherent plot threads. Persistent critical controversy stems from poorly executed Mystery Box IP like late Lost seasons, where unmanaged unresolved riddles alienated audiences. Additional unresolved research gaps include longitudinal audience engagement data comparing box-structured serials against closed-arc dramas, and standardized payoff balance rubrics for layered mystery hierarchies.

Classic Hitchcockian suspense design treats mystery as a disposable plot device resolved by a film’s final act, a limitation incompatible with long-form serialized streaming storytelling. Abrams’ Mystery Box theory rejects this closed-arc constraint, framing unresolved layered curiosity as the permanent structural backbone of a story rather than a temporary twist. The unopened magic box metaphor illustrates the central thesis: imagination and audience participation peak when full answers are withheld, inviting viewers to co-create theories between episodes or film sequences. The framework does not advocate for zero resolution—instead it advocates staggered, partial payoffs across nested tiers, balancing ongoing intrigue with periodic satisfying reveals. Transmedia extensions (books, games) expand the box’s mystery layers without rushing the main narrative’s central core payoff.

Abrams’ 2007 TED Mystery Box foundational narrative theory reworks classic suspense design for serialized streaming media via a three-tier nested curiosity hierarchy, anchored to his childhood unopened magic box metaphor. Distinct from Hitchcock’s single-film closed MacGuffin, the open-ended box structure layers fast-resolving micro character secrets, gradual mid-plot enigmas, and a single overarching central core mystery that unfolds across multiple story installments. Partial staggered payoffs maintain steady audience satisfaction while sustaining long-term speculative fan engagement, with supplementary transmedia tools able to expand mystery layers without rushing the main arc’s thematic finale. While limited by the requirement for unifying core themes and incompatibility with fully closed procedural formats, this framework remains the dominant structural blueprint for modern bingeable serialized suspense and cross-platform franchise worldbuilding.
